Esterly: The Dynamic Voice of Modern Alt-Pop

Esterly is a British alt-pop singer-songwriter known for her emotionally charged lyrics and genre-blending soundscapes. Hailing from Manchester, she achieved mainstream recognition with her 2022 debut album "Chromatic," which charted in the UK Top 20 and spawned several certified silver singles.

Early career

Born Esther Leigh in 1996, Esterly began writing songs as a teenager, posting acoustic covers and original demos to YouTube from her bedroom. Her raw vocal talent and introspective songwriting caught the attention of independent label Neon Echo Records, which signed her in 2018 and released her first EP, "Frayed Edges," that same year.

Breakthrough

Esterly's breakthrough arrived in 2021 with the viral success of her single "Glass Houses." The track's atmospheric production and candid exploration of mental health resonated widely, leading to a major-label signing with Parlophone. "Glass Houses" eventually peaked at number 15 on the UK Singles Chart and was certified silver.

Following the success of "Chromatic," Esterly embarked on a sold-out UK and European tour. She has since collaborated with notable producers like RITUAL and fellow alt-pop artist Orla Gartland, whose clever lyricism and melodic instincts share clear parallels. Her music also draws comparisons to the atmospheric pop of Mitski and the bold electronic textures of Chvrches.

Esterly's second album, "Neural Pathways," released in 2024, debuted at number 12 on the UK Albums Chart. The record further experimented with glitchy electronics and layered vocals, solidifying her position as a forward-thinking artist in the modern alt-pop scene.
